User-centric design prioritizes the needs and preferences of the user when creating a website. This approach can significantly enhance user engagement and improve conversion rates.
User experience plays a crucial role in how visitors interact with your website. A positive UX leads to higher satisfaction and retention rates.
Some key elements to consider include intuitive navigation, fast loading times, and mobile responsiveness. These factors contribute to an overall positive impression of your brand.
To create a truly user-centric website, conducting user research is essential. Understanding the preferences and behaviors of your target audience can inform your design decisions.
Use surveys, interviews, and usability tests to gather valuable insights from users. This data will guide you in making informed design choices that resonate with your audience.
Every element on your website should serve a purpose. Aim for a design that not only looks great but also enhances functionality.
While aesthetics are important, functionality should never be compromised. A beautiful website that is difficult to navigate will drive visitors away.
Once your website is live, gather feedback from users to identify areas for improvement. Continuous iteration based on user feedback can significantly enhance the overall experience.
Don’t hesitate to make adjustments based on user suggestions. The goal is to create a website that truly meets their needs.
Creating a user-centric website is essential for fostering engagement and driving conversions. By prioritizing the needs of your users, your brand can achieve a competitive edge in the digital space.
